Selecting the Best Plants for Your Landscaping Design
Picking the right plants for landscaping design is vital, as they not only boost visual appeal but also influence the overall health of the ecosystem. A professional landscaping company can guide property owners in selecting plants that flourish in their specific climate and soil conditions. It is important to factor in elements such as sunlight, water availability, and the local wildlife when selecting plants.
Local plant species are frequently suggested, as they need less maintenance and offer habitat for local fauna. Furthermore, incorporating a mix of perennials, annuals, and shrubs can create year-round interest and structure in the landscape. Color, texture, and seasonal variations should also be taken into account to ensure a dynamic and engaging design.
Finally, a carefully planned selection of plants can significantly elevate the property's visual appeal while promoting sustainability and biodiversity in the nearby environment.
Incorporating Hardscaping Elements Within Your Yard
Including hardscaping elements into a landscaping project enhances the natural beauty delivered by plants. Hardscaping refers to the non-plant features of a landscape, such as patios, walkways, retaining walls, and decorative stones. These structures add framework and functionality to outdoor spaces while enhancing visual appeal.
For instance, a well-placed stone pathway can lead visitors through a garden, creating a sense of discovery. Retaining walls can efficiently manage slopes, avoiding erosion while adding visual interest to the landscape. Furthermore, incorporating features like decorative boulders or gravel beds can divide large areas of greenery, providing contrast and texture.
Furthermore, selecting materials that blend with the existing environment is vital. Natural brick or stone, for example, can create a fluid shift between hardscape and softscape. Eventually, hardscaping enriches the overall landscape, offering both decorative value and practical benefits for property owners.

Native Plant Choices
Choosing native plants for landscaping not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of a property but also supports local biodiversity and sustainability. These plants are ideally matched to the local climate, needing less maintenance and fewer resources than non-native species. By picking native flora, property owners support local wildlife, including pollinators such as bees and butterflies, which are vital for a healthy ecosystem. In addition, native plants minimize soil erosion and boost water absorption, adding to overall environmental health. A professional landscaping company can help homeowners in choosing the right native species that match their design preferences while ensuring ecological balance. Ultimately, incorporating native plants fosters a connection to the local environment, improving both the landscape and the community.
Effective Sprinkler Systems
Integrating efficient irrigation systems into a landscaping plan complements the use of native plants by ensuring they receive the perfect amount of water without unnecessary waste. These systems, such as drip irrigation and smart controllers, deliver water directly to plant roots, reducing evaporation and runoff. By utilizing rainwater harvesting and greywater recycling, property owners can further boost water sustainability, making certain that resources are used prudently. Furthermore, effective irrigation assists in maintain soil health and reduces the need for chemical fertilizers, fostering a more sustainable landscape. Professional landscaping companies can design and install tailored irrigation solutions suited to specific plant needs and local climate conditions, ultimately leading to thriving, sustainable outdoor spaces that flourish with minimal water consumption.
Natural Soil Methods
Though countless homeowners aim to elevate their landscape design, adopting organic soil practices is essential for cultivating a healthy ecosystem. These practices prioritize the use of natural amendments, such as compost, to boost soil fertility and structure. By steering clear of synthetic fertilizers and pesticides, homeowners can reduce harmful effects on local wildlife and groundwater. Furthermore, incorporating organic mulches increases moisture retention and reduces weed growth, improving soil health over time. Practices like crop rotation and cover cropping also promote nutrient cycling and stop soil erosion. Professional landscaping companies can deliver guidance on executing these techniques, ensuring properties not only prosper aesthetically but also support sustainable environmental practices. Ultimately, organic soil practices create a robust landscape that benefits both homeowners and the neighboring ecosystem.
Budget Planning Guidelines for Your Landscaping Project: What to Think About
When beginning a landscaping project, thorough budgeting is crucial to guarantee that the vision aligns with financial reality. Initially, individuals should establish their overall budget, taking into account both hard and soft costs. Hard costs encompass materials, plants, and labor, while soft costs encompass design fees and permits.
Subsequently, it is prudent to give priority to essential features, such as watering systems and hardscaping, over aesthetic elements like decorative greenery. Researching local prices for supplies and labor can offer a clear view of expected expenses.
Furthermore, integrating a contingency fund—commonly 10-20% of the total budget—accounts for unexpected costs that may emerge during the project. Lastly, exploring seasonal discounts or off-peak hiring can result in notable savings. By adhering to these guidelines, homeowners can establish a sustainable budget that enables their landscaping goals without sacrificing financial stability.
